What Tennr Actually Does
Tennr isn't just another OCR tool with some AI sprinkled on top. The company built RaeLLM™ 7B, a document reasoning model trained specifically on over 3 million healthcare documents. This specialization matters because healthcare paperwork has its own language, formats, and regulatory requirements that general AI models simply don't understand well enough.
When you feed documents into Tennr, it doesn't just extract text. It understands context. It knows the difference between a prior authorization request and a referral form. It recognizes when an insurance company needs additional information versus when they're just stalling. This contextual understanding is what drives their claimed 97% human auto-approval rate - meaning 97% of the time, Tennr's automated decisions match what a human reviewer would decide.

Core Technology That Actually Works
The RaeLLM™ 7B model deserves attention because it represents a shift from general-purpose AI to domain-specific intelligence. Training on 3 million healthcare documents means the system has seen virtually every type of form, denial letter, and authorization request in the industry. This training allows Tennr to handle the messy reality of healthcare documents - poor scans, handwritten notes, inconsistent formats, and industry-specific jargon.
What impressed me most during testing was how Tennr handles edge cases. When it encounters something unusual or ambiguous, it doesn't just fail silently. It flags the document for human review with specific questions about what's confusing. This feedback loop helps the system learn over time, which means Tennr should get better the longer you use it.

Integration and Setup
This is where Tennr shows its enterprise focus. The platform integrates with major EHR systems like Epic, Cerner, and Allscripts, but the integration depth varies. Some connections are plug-and-play, while others require custom API development. The initial setup typically takes 4-8 weeks, including:
- System configuration and workflow mapping
- EHR integration and data mapping
- Document type training and validation
- Staff training and process adjustment
The complexity here is real, but necessary. Healthcare workflows aren't standardized, so Tennr needs to adapt to how your specific practice operates.

Key Capabilities
Document Classification and Extraction: Tennr doesn't just read text - it understands document types. The system automatically identifies whether you're dealing with an insurance claim, referral form, prior authorization, or patient communication. This classification happens instantly, routing documents to the correct workflow without human intervention. For extraction, Tennr pulls specific data points like patient information, diagnosis codes, procedure dates, and insurance details with remarkable accuracy.
Automated Requests and Follow-ups: This is where Tennr saves significant staff time. When documents require additional information or action, Tennr automatically generates and sends requests. More importantly, it tracks responses and sends follow-ups when needed. The system maintains complete audit trails of all communications, which is crucial for compliance and tracking purposes in healthcare environments.
Insurance and Authorization Handling: Tennr specializes in the most frustrating part of healthcare paperwork: dealing with insurance companies. The system understands different payer requirements, formats submissions correctly, and even anticipates common denial reasons. For prior authorizations, Tennr can prepare complete packets with all necessary documentation, significantly reducing the back-and-forth that typically delays patient care.
EHR Integration: Tennr connects directly with major electronic health record systems including Epic, Cerner, and Allscripts. This integration allows seamless data flow between clinical and administrative systems. When Tennr processes a document, relevant information automatically updates patient records, billing systems, and scheduling platforms. This eliminates duplicate data entry and reduces errors from manual transcription.
Patient Communication Management: Beyond internal documents, Tennr handles patient-facing communications. The system can generate appointment reminders, procedure instructions, billing statements, and follow-up requests. All communications maintain HIPAA compliance and can be customized to match your practice's voice and branding. The platform also manages patient responses, flagging urgent issues for immediate staff attention.
Workflow Automation and Analytics: Tennr provides complete visibility into your document processing pipeline. The dashboard shows real-time metrics on processing times, approval rates, bottlenecks, and staff productivity. More importantly, Tennr learns from your workflows. As it processes more documents, it identifies patterns and suggests optimizations to make your entire operation more efficient over time.

Based on independent testing and user reports, Tennr achieves approximately 97% accuracy on standard healthcare document types when measured against human reviewers. This high accuracy comes from the specialized RaeLLM™ 7B model trained on 3 million healthcare documents. For common forms like insurance claims and prior authorizations, accuracy often exceeds 98%. However, accuracy decreases slightly with poor quality scans, handwritten notes, or extremely unusual document formats. The system is designed to flag low-confidence documents for human review rather than guessing, which maintains overall reliability.
Tennr offers direct integration with major EHR platforms including Epic, Cerner, Allscripts, and NextGen. The depth of integration varies by system - some connections are pre-built and plug-and-play, while others require custom API development. For less common EHR systems, Tennr typically offers file-based integration or can develop custom connections for additional fees. During implementation, Tennr's team works with your IT staff to map data fields and ensure smooth information flow between systems. Most integrations maintain real-time synchronization, though some smaller systems may use batch processing.
Implementation timelines range from 4 to 8 weeks for most organizations. The process includes: Week 1-2: System configuration and workflow analysis; Week 3-4: EHR integration and data mapping; Week 5-6: Document type training and validation testing; Week 7-8: Staff training and gradual rollout. Complex organizations with multiple locations or unusual workflows might require additional time. The single biggest factor affecting implementation speed is how quickly your team can provide sample documents for training and validate the system's performance. Organizations that dedicate a project manager to the implementation typically complete it faster and with better results.
Tennr can process handwritten notes, but with reduced automation rates compared to typed documents. The system uses advanced handwriting recognition trained on medical handwriting samples, but accuracy varies significantly based on handwriting quality. For legible handwriting, Tennr typically achieves 85-90% accuracy on key data points. For poor handwriting, the system will flag the document for human transcription. Most practices use Tennr for handwritten notes by having the system extract what it can confidently read, then presenting the document to a human for verification and completion of unclear sections. This hybrid approach still saves time compared to full manual processing.
When Tennr encounters a document type it hasn't been trained on, it follows a specific workflow: First, it attempts to classify the document based on similar known types. If classification confidence is low, it routes the document to a human reviewer with a request to identify the document type. Once identified, Tennr can either process it using similar document logic or flag it for custom training. For organizations with unique document needs, Tennr offers custom training services to teach the system new document types. This training typically requires 50-100 sample documents and takes 1-2 weeks to implement.
Tennr is built with healthcare compliance as a core requirement. The platform is HIPAA compliant and HITRUST certified. All data is encrypted both in transit and at rest using AES-256 encryption. Tennr signs Business Associate Agreements (BAAs) with all healthcare customers. The system maintains complete audit trails of all document access and modifications. Data residency options allow organizations to choose where their data is stored geographically. Regular security audits and penetration testing ensure ongoing compliance. For organizations with additional regulatory requirements (like research institutions or government facilities), Tennr offers enhanced security configurations and compliance documentation.
